R109LHW Low High Wide Chirp Thru-Hull Transducer with Fairing Block - No Connector
Get more coverage under the boat with Airmar’s unique wide-beam, low- and high-frequency, Chirp-ready R109LHW. The high band operates across a frequency range of 150 to 250 kHz and has a fixed 25-degree beam for all frequencies, which results in superior resolution. The constantly wide beam provides twice the coverage and clear fish arches on the display compared to most high-frequency, narrow-beam transducers.
The high-wide is the ideal choice for both inshore and pelagic fishing, where resolution and maximum coverage under the boat are essentially down to 152 m (500'). The low-frequency band and 2 kW of power also support great deep-water performance. Get the best of both worlds with Airmar’s Chirp-ready transducer with wide-beam coverage.
Features:
- Depth and fast-response water-temperature sensing
 - 2 kW of power for excellent deep-water performance from the low-frequency
 - 2 kW low frequency (38 to 75 kHz): 19 to 10-degree port-starboard beamwidth; 10 to 5-degree fore-aft beamwidth
 - Maximum depth of 1829 m (6000')
 - 1kW high frequency (150 to 250 kHz): 25-degree constant beamwidth; Maximum depth of 152 m (500')
 - 137 kHz of total bandwidth from one transducer
 - Covers popular fishing frequencies of 50, 68, and 200 kHz plus everything else in the bandwidth
 - High frequency delivers superior shallow-water performance, bottom detail, and fish-target separation
 - High wide beamwidth yields more coverage for detecting fish in the upper-water column
 - Urethane housing with fairing for optimal performance
 - No Connector - Bare Wire
 - Comes with Fairing Block
 - Patented Xducer ID® technology
 
Specifications:
- Acoustic Window: Epoxy/urethane
 - Common Use: Fishing, commercial fishing
 - Functions: Depth, temperature
 - High Frequency: 150-250 kHz
 - High-Wide Beamwidth: 25 degrees
 - Housing: Urethane
 - Hull Material: Compatible with all hull materials
 - Low-Frequency: 38-75 kHz
 - Low-Frequency Beamwidth: 19-10 degrees
 - Max Deadrise: Up to 22 degrees
 - Max Deadrise Angle: 22 degrees
 - Max Depth: Low frequency- 1829 m (6000'), High wide frequency- 152 m (500')
 - Max Vessel LOA: 9 m (30') and above
 - Mounting Style: Thru-hull
 - Power Rating: 2 kW
 - Retractable housing: No
 - Single or Dual Frequency: CHIRP-ready dual-band
 - Tilted Element: No
 - Weight: 15.1 kg (33.3 lb.)
